Exporting Labor to Europe

As Western Europe faces labor shortages and an aging population, Eastern European countries like **Romania, Poland, Hungary, and Croatia** have become the new frontier for Bangladeshi migrant workers. This shift represents a move towards higher-standard living and regulated employment.

Why Europe?

  • Standardized Wages: Minimum wage laws ensure fair pay.
  • Worker Rights: Strong labor laws protect against exploitation.
  • Gateway Potential: Experience in Eastern Europe can be a stepping stone to other EU markets.

Sectors in Demand

The shortage is acute in:

  • Construction: Masons, steel fixers, and carpenters.
  • Logistics: Truck drivers and warehouse operators.
  • Manufacturing: Factory production line and textile workers.
